ABOUT THE ROLE Physical design is where AI-driven chip design gets graded: every placement, clock tree, routing, and optimization our systems produce must ultimately converge to signoff-clean GDSII in an advanced node. To close the loop between our AI and real silicon, we need an engineer who knows every step of the flow cold, from synthesis through tapeout, and who has personally fought complex blocks to closure at an advanced node. Your expertise becomes the ground truth our self-improving systems learn from and are measured against. You will participate in developing the architecture of Ricursive's physical design flow end to end, both top-down (chip-level planning, partitioning, budgeting, hierarchical signoff) and bottom-up (block construction and closure feeding full-chip assembly), and you will pair that flow with AI tooling, ours and the industry's, to make each iteration faster than the last. This is a small and early team, so the methodology and infrastructure are still being defined; you will define them.
